In addition to his responsibilities as a member of the Board of Directors, Mr. Katz is Chairman of E-I-A Acquisition Corporation, whose holdings include Quali-Plastic, a large Hungarian chemical distribution company. He is also Chairman of Polymeric Resources Corporation, a nylon reprocessing company located in Wayne, N.J. Mr. Katz served as President and Chief Operating Officer of Peabody International Corporation, a Fortune 500 company, from 1983 until its merger with The Pullman Company in late 1985. Mr. Katz served as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er of Peabody from 1981 to 1983, and was a Director from 1977 to 1985. Prior to joining Peabody in 1973, Mr. Katz held a variety of management positions with Westinghouse Electric Corporation, where he served for 18 years and was directly involved in the launching of new products, divisions and subsidiaries.
Mr. Katz received his Bachelors of Chemical Engineering from Brooklyn Polytechnic Institute and his Masters of Chemical Engineering from New York University. |
